About
United States Postal Service

Visit your local Post Office at 1234 Market St! The U.S. Postal Service (USPS) is the only organization in the country to regularly deliver to every residential and business address. USPS is actively recruiting for many positions, including: mail and package delivery (city and rural); truck driving (delivery truck and tractor trailer); processing plant; and more opportunities to fit your needs.
